0 reports about 2426293594The number was first reported 3rd Aug, 2025
Received a phone call from 2426293594? Report here
File a report about 2426293594 |
Phone Number Variations: 2426293594, 02426-293594, 912426293594, 002426293594, 1912426293594, +1912426293594